MDMTEST0 (0x61B8) – Test Register for Modem
Bit Name Reset R/W Description
No.
7:4
TX_TONE[3:0]
0111 R/W Enables the possibility to transmit a baseband tone by picking samples from the sine
tables with a controllable phase step between the samples. The step size is
controlled by TX_TONE. If MDMTEST1.MOD_IF is 0, the tone is superpositioned on
the modulated data, effectively giving modulation with an IF. If MDMTEST1.MOD_IF is
1, only the tone is transmitted.
0000: –6 MHz
0001: –4 MHz
0010: –3 MHz
0011: –2 MHz
0100: –1 MHz
0101: –500 kHz
0110: –4 kHz
0111: 0
1000: 4 kHz
1001: 500 kHz
1010: 1 MHz
1011: 2 MHz
1100: 3 MHz
1101: 4 MHz
1110: 6 MHz
Others: Reserved
3:2
DC_WIN_SIZE[1:0]
01 R/W Controls the number of samples to be accumulated between each dump of the
accumulate-and-dump filter used in dc removal.
00: 32 samples
01: 64 samples
10: 128 samples
11: 256 samples
1:0
DC_BLOCK_MODE[1:0]
01 R/W Selects the mode of operation:
00: The input signal to the dc blocker is passed on to the output without any
attempt to remove dc.
01: Enable dc cancellation. Normal operation
10: Freeze estimates of dc when sync is found. Start estimating dc again when
searching for the next frame
11: Reserved
MDMTEST1 (0x61B9) – Test Register for Modem
Bit Name Reset R/W Description
No.
7:5 – 000 R0 Reserved. Read as 0
4
MOD_IF
0 R/W
0: Modulation is performed at an IF set by MDMTEST0.TX_TONE.
1: A tone is transmitted with frequency set by MDMTEST0.TX_TONE.
3
RAMP_AMP
1 R/W 1: Enable ramping of DAC output amplitude during startup and finish.
0: Disable ramping of DAC output amplitude
2
RFC_SNIFF_EN
0 R/W 0: Packet sniffer module disabled
1: Packet sniffer module enabled. The received and transmitted data can be
observed on GPIO pins.
1
MODULATION_MODE
0 R/W Set one of two RF modulation modes for RX/TX
0: IEEE 802.15.4 compliant mode
1: Reversed phase, non-IEEE compliant
0 RESERVED 0 R/W Reserved. Do not write.
